General Guidelines
Following are general guidelines for all access points.
Always try to mount the AP as close to the users as possible for best performance. Be aware of the 
environment. For example, if hospitals have metal doors, coverage can change when the doors close. 
Old buildings can have metal grid work hidden under plaster or asbestos. Avoid mounting the AP or 
antennas near metal objects, since that may affect the coverage area.

Try to determine which clients will be used and check the coverage using those clients. For example, 
a PDA or Wi-Fi phone might not have the same range as a notebook or tablet.
Tip: Verify coverage using the worst performing clients that you intend to deploy.
